Role Overview:

The Accounts Payable Senior Executive is responsible for managing and overseeing the entire accounts payable process, ensuring accurate and timely processing of invoices, expense reports, and vendor payments. This role also involves maintaining strong relationships with vendors and internal stakeholders, ensuring compliance with organizational policies and financial regulations.

Knowledge of FP&A is a plus.

Key Responsibilities:

Invoice Processing:

  • Review, verify, and process invoices accurately and on time.
  • Match invoices to purchase orders and resolve discrepancies.

Payment Management:

  • Prepare and execute payment runs (electronic transfers, checks, etc.).
  • Ensure timely payment to vendors and maintain a clear record of payment schedules.

Vendor Management:

  • Maintain vendor records, including contact information, tax details, and payment terms.
  • Handle vendor queries and resolve payment issues promptly.

Reconciliation:

  • Perform monthly reconciliation of accounts payable ledgers and vendor statements.
  • Ensure all outstanding balances are identified and addressed.

Compliance and Reporting:

  • Ensure adherence to internal financial controls and comp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Prepare and present periodic accounts payable reports to management.

Process Improvement:

  • Identify and recommend opportunities to streamline the accounts payable process.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to improve workflows.
